                  Should be a good game tonight....

                  JV and Drummond renew acquaintances and that’s always a good matchup....JV seems to get his game up for Andre and he should be rested after not seeing the floor to much vs the Hinkies on a mix of fouls and matchup circumstances.

                  Ish Smith and Lowry go head to head but with Reggie Jackson out next guy up for the Mowtowners is Dwight Buycks ?...Have to exploit that one.

                  The Pistons have some pretty good wings in Harris and Bradley along with the streaky Langston Galloway who has his share of good nights vs the Raps.

                  If DD continues to get the better of Bradley and betweenOG and Siakam we hold Harris in check the Raps with the home court should come out ahead....

                  Raps get off their two game slide and post a W tonight.
